+2004-10-22 Paul Eggert <eggert@cs.ucla.edu>
+
+ * doc/bison.texinfo (Language and Grammar): In example, "int" is a
+ keyword, not an identifier. Problem reported by Baron Schwartz in
+ <http://lists.gnu.org/archive/html/bug-bison/2004-10/msg00017.html>.
+
+2004-10-11 Akim Demaille <akim@epita.fr>
+
+ * src/symtab.c (symbol_check_alias_consistency): Also check
+ type names, destructors, and printers.
+ Reported by Alexandre Duret-Lutz.
+ Recode the handling of associativity and precedence in terms
+ of symbol_precedence_set.
+ Accept no redeclaration at all, not even equal to the previous
+ value.
+ (redeclaration): New.
+ Use it to factor redeclaration complaints.
+ (symbol_make_alias): Don't set the type of the alias, let
+ symbol_check_alias_consistency do it as for other features.
+ * src/symtab.h (symbol): Add new member prec_location, and
+ type_location.
+ * src/symtab.c (symbol_precedence_set, symbol_type_set): Set them.
+ * tests/input.at (Incompatible Aliases): New.
+
+2004-10-09 Paul Eggert <eggert@cs.ucla.edu>
+
+ .cvsignore fixes to accommodate gnulib changes,
+ and the practice of naming build directories "_build".
+ * .cvsignore: Add "_*". Sort.
+ * lib/.cvsignore: Add getopt_.h, xalloc-die.c.
+ * m4/.cvsignore: Add "*_gl.m4".
+
+2004-10-06 Akim Demaille <akim@epita.fr>
+
+ * src/parse-gram.y (add_param): Fix the truncation of trailing
+ spaces.
+
+2004-10-05 Akim Demaille <akim@epita.fr>
+
+ In Bison 1.875's yacc.c, YYLLOC_DEFAULT was called regardless
+ whether the reducion was empty or not. This leaves room to
+ improve the use of YYLLOC_DEFAULT in such a case.
+ lalr1.cc is still experimental, so changing this is acceptable.
+ And finally, there are probably not many users who changed the
+ handling of locations in GLR, so changing is admissible too.
+
+ * data/glr.c, data/lalr1.cc, data/yacc.c (YYLLOC_DEFAULT): On an
+ empty reduction, set @$ to an empty location ending the previously
+ stacked symbol.
+ Adjust uses to make sure the code is triggered on empty
+ reductions.
+ * tests/actions.at (_AT_CHECK_PRINTER_AND_DESTRUCTOR): Adjust the
+ expected output: empty reductions have empty locations.
+
+2004-09-29 Akim Demaille <akim@epita.fr>
+
+ * data/lalr1.cc: Move towards a more standard C++ coding style
+ for templates: Class < T > -> Class<T>.
+
2004-09-29 Akim Demaille <akim@epita.fr>
* data/lalr1.cc: Reinstall the former ctor, for sake of